Insomniac confirms Marvel’s Wolverine is still set for fall 2026 marking the first entry of an X-Men trilogy

Insomniac Games has reiterated that Marvel’s Wolverine remains slated for Fall 2026, activating PlayStation Store wishlists and confirming the project as the first entry in an X‑Men trilogy, though no exact release date has been set.

Insomniac Games has doubled down on a Fall 2026 launch for Marvel’s Wolverine, reiterating to fans that the game remains on track for its scheduled release date, and the timing is uncanny considering this was announced right after Rockstar delayed GTA VI into November 2026.

Insomniac Games announced in a post on X, signaling to fans, stating, “Don’t miss a shred of information. Wishlist Marvel’s Wolverine, coming Fall 2026,” along with a link to the game’s PlayStation store page, where wishlists are now live.

It’s pretty convenient for Insomniac to post this just days after Rockstar Games delayed Grand Theft Auto VI from its planned May 26, 2026, release to November 19, 2026, as the studio stated they need additional time for polish.

With GTA VI pushed back toward the end of 2026, Insomniac Games is likely on track to dominate with early holiday sales, without having to overlap with GTA VI’s release.

However, the studio has yet to reveal an exact release date for the game. Marvel’s Wolverine was a brewing concept during the ongoing development of 2018’s Marvel Spider-Man, with talks between Sony Interactive Entertainment, Marvel Games, and Insomniac Games.

Recently, on November 4, Marvel Games general manager Haluk Mentus praised Insomniac during a Game Informer interview, stating, “We have been working together for more than a decade and developed such a shorthand across multiple Marvel’s Spider-Man games that when the time finally came to bring Logan back in spectacular and visceral fashion, it was obvious to everyone that Insomniac was the perfect choice.”

By September 2021, Insomniac Games officially announced that Marvel’s Wolverine was in development with a brief teaser trailer during a PlayStation Showcase event. Unfortunately for Insomniac Games and to the surprise of many gamers, a targeted ransomware attack on the studio in December 2023 leaked Wolverine’s story assets and mechanics, followed by a clunky playable build.

However, Insomniac Games went quiet about Marvel’s Wolverine’s development after December 2023, with many fearing the project had been canceled amid the ransomware attack, along with a standalone Marvel’s Venom game. 

Fortunately, this does not seem to be the case as Insomniac dropped a two-minute gameplay trailer during Sony’s September 24, 2025, State of Play. From what we know so far, Marvel’s Wolverine is reported to be the first installment in a trilogy leading up to a series of titles featuring the X-Men.
